[quote=ra] Has anyone in here tested out the offline mode from the file menu? I just tried it a bit (running 0.9 RC1 on Win XP SP2) and I think it is sometimes behaving quite strange (well, buggy, but it's still a nice addition to K-M). [b]1.)[/b] If offline is checked and I open a page that is not cached I get a nice XUL error page (I have XUL error pages enabled) telling me that the page is not available offline and what I could do. So far so great. So I do what the page says and uncheck offline, erm, well ..., I try to, but the check mark doesn't disappear. But it will disappear the second time I uncheck offline mode. In fact *every* page load (even a reload of a cached page) while in offline mode will lead to this state (= K-M requires double-unchecking later on to get back into online mode). [b]2.)[/b]If I check offline while a page is loading the loading stalls, but it doesn't stop. The page continues to load endlessly (without any progress of course). Might be okay, but probably not what a user expects (that would probably be cancelling loading and a partial display and/or a error message). [b]3.)[/b] Minor thing: If K-M is closed in *offline* mode it will be in *online* mode again when it is started. Depending on what you expect that's either a bug or nice. ;-) I'm tending to nice after thinking a bit about it. It's a browser after all. <g> So, let's skip 3.) [b]4.)[/b]I'm not sure if it matters if layers are enabled for the following bug. I only tested with *disabled layers*. Please follow carefully. :-) - Exit K-M and open it again (=> window1) [or leave only one window open...] - Now check offline in window1. - Open a new window (=> window2). (- Notice that offline is still checked in window2 and window1.) - Close window1(!). (- Notice that offline mode is still checked in - the remaining - window2.) - Now open a new window (=> window3). => Oops, offline mode will be *unchecked*. Bug. => Now try to load a page that's not in the cache. You'll get an error message - K-M is still in offline mode, although the menu isn't checked anymore. Bug. => At this point you'll have to click offline *three* times to get back into online mode (or just exit and restart the browser). That's what I noticed so far after a few minutes of testing.[/quote]
